Hobo Casserole Ground Beef (Print)

Layers of ground beef, potatoes, and cheese create a warm, satisfying main fit for weeknight dinners.

# Ingredients:

→ Meat

01 - 450 g ground beef

→ Produce

02 - 1 medium onion, chopped
03 - 2 cloves garlic, minced
04 - 4 to 5 medium potatoes, thinly sliced
05 - Fresh parsley, chopped (optional, for garnish)

→ Dairy

06 - 170 g shredded cheddar cheese
07 - 50 g grated Parmesan cheese
08 - 60 ml milk (optional, for creaminess)

→ Pantry

09 - 1 tablespoon olive oil
10 - 1 teaspoon dried Italian seasoning
11 - 1/2 teaspoon paprika
12 - Salt, to taste
13 - Black pepper, to taste
14 - 120 ml beef broth or water

# Steps:

01 - Preheat oven to 190°C. Lightly grease a 23 x 33 cm baking dish with cooking spray or olive oil.
02 -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add ground beef and cook, breaking apart with a spoon, until fully browned, around 5 to 7 minutes. Drain excess fat if necessary.
03 - Add chopped onion and minced garlic to the skillet. Cook for 3 to 4 minutes until the onion becomes soft and translucent.
04 - Transfer beef mixture evenly into prepared baking dish. Layer thinly sliced potatoes over the beef in an even layer. Season potatoes with salt, black pepper, Italian seasoning, and paprika.
05 - Sprinkle shredded cheddar and grated Parmesan cheese evenly over the potatoes. Pour beef broth or water around the edges of the dish. Drizzle milk over the potatoes for additional creaminess if desired.
06 - Cover the dish tightly with aluminium foil. Bake for 30 minutes.
07 - Remove the foil and continue to bake for 15 to 20 minutes, or until potatoes are tender and cheese is golden and bubbling.
08 - Sprinkle with chopped fresh parsley if desired. Serve hot.
